Ho’ike – March 3rd
Ho’ike is Hearts in Motion’s end-of-session performance. Each class will get to share what they have learned and practiced in a concert-style format in New Hope’s Main Auditorium.
General Information
Sunday, March 3rd
6:00 p.m.*
New Hope Oahu Main Auditorium
Food Court Opens at 5:00 p.m.
Free Admission
*Dancers must arrive by 4:00 p.m. for rehearsal.
Dancer Call Time: 4:00 p.m.
